The 2017 Chevrolet Camaro ZL1 is an eye-popping sweet- handling GMA Alpha platform with a serious speed of 650 horsepower with 650 lb-ft of supercharged 6.2 liter LT4 V-8. It incorporates 11 heat exchangers to avoid various fluids from overheating and a magnetic suspension, summer tires, and electronically locking limited-slip.

According to Motor Trend, the senior features editor Jonny Lieberman finds some back roads to test the 2017 Chevrolet Camaro ZL1 on the real-world performance and praises the all-new optional 10-speed automatic transmission. The six-speed manual version of the Camaro ZL1 is controlled through a suede-wrapped shifter that travels throughout the gates with its precision.

The 2017 Chevrolet Camaro ZL1 is GM's first recipient of 10-speed automatic, denoted as HydraMatic 10R90. The Chevrolet engineers use more robust clutches, planetary carriers, and output gears, as they change the use of another converter and shift-control software. The ignition has an impressive 10th-to-third -gear downshifts as it takes the throttle while cruising at the speed of 60 mph.
